Explore Boston Harbor Islands

Kids love exploring the outdoors and there’s no better place than Boston Harbor Islands. This National and State Park is home to America’s oldest light station and a scenic beach that’s perfect for one last playful day in the sand. Bring your littlest ones to Toddler Tuesdays where preschoolers can go on a nature walk, explore the beach, and enjoy storytelling.

Storytelling at Faneuil Hall Marketplace

Encourage your kiddos to gather around a captivating storyteller to hear some of Boston’s most riveting tales. Catch professional storytellers at Faneuil Hall Marketplace every Tuesday through the end of October at the new outdoor reading room on South Market Street.

Friday Night at the Boston Children’s Museum

Explore any of the famed Boston Children’s Museum exhibits during the museum’s $1 admission night, every Friday from 5-9 p.m. Help your little ones dig, climb, and create a city in Construction Zone or encourage older kids to learn about a different culture at the Japanese House exhibit.

Stroll Through the Public Garden

Most everyone loves Boston’s Public Garden, and children are no exception! They can climb on the Make Way for Ducklings sculpture and see the classic children’s story come to life. Kiddos can also make a wish at one of the many fountains or play hide and seek among the park’s majestic trees. You can even jump on a swan boat to see the park in style!
